Mikrobiol., <strong>76<\/strong>: 126\u2013131. 1971. W.H. Blackwell et al. 2002 disagree. See: Mycotaxon 83: 183\u2013190.<\/p>\n<p><strong><em>Chytridium olla<\/em><\/strong> A. Braun [Chytridiales, Chytridiceae sensu V\u00e9lez et al.] MycoBank no.: 153717. Mycologia 103: 118\u2013130. 2011. Velez et al (2011) designated figures in Braun&#8217;s 1855 publication as<strong> lectotype<\/strong>, stating that the type no longer existed. F.K. Sparrow , however, had earlier located and photographed the species from a packet labeled &#8220;<em>Chytridium olla<\/em> A. Br. <em>Oedogonium Landsboroughii<\/em>, Freiburg in B. legit. A. Braun&#8221; in the Institute de Botanique at Strasbourg. See: F.K. Sparrow &#8220;The <strong>type<\/strong> of <em>Chytridium olla<\/em> A. Braun&#8221;. Taxon 22: 583\u2013586. 1973. I believe that the Velez et al. lectotype should, instead, be considered an <strong>epitype<\/strong>.<\/p>\n<p><strong><em>Chytridium ottariense<\/em><\/strong> (IF 4:241) Roane; Mycologia,<strong> 65<\/strong>: 531\u2013538, figs. 3\u201314. 1973<br \/>\nSaprobic; <em>Volvox<\/em>, chitin, snake skin; impoundment; Pulaski County, VIRGINIA, USA<\/p>\n<p><strong><em>Chytridium parasiticum<\/em><\/strong> Willoughby 1956 \u2261 <em>Chytriomyces willoughbyi <\/em>(Willoughby) Karling; Mycopath. See: Mycotaxon <strong>83<\/strong>: 183\u2013190<\/p>\n<p><strong><em>Chytriomyces<\/em> <\/strong>Karling 1945 includes<em> Amphicypellus<\/em> Ingold 1944; I.J. Dogma: Philipp. J. Biol. <strong>5<\/strong>: 121\u2013142 (p. 136). 1976. Dogma lists <em>Chytriomyces<\/em> as &#8220;nomen conservandum&#8221;; however <em>Chytriomyces<\/em> is not on the conserved list in the Tokyo Code. For a taxonomic summary of the genus and designation of <em>C. hyalinus<\/em> as <strong>lectotype<\/strong>, see: P.M. Letcher and M.J. Powell, 2002. A taxonomic summary of <em>Chytriomyces<\/em> (Chytridiomycota). Mycotaxon <strong>84<\/strong>: 447\u2013487. (includes key to species of <em>Chytriomyces<\/em>)<\/p>\n<p><strong><em>Chytriomyces angularis<\/em><\/strong> Longcore; Mycologia 84: 442\u2013451, figs. 1\u201328. 1992<br \/>\nSaprobic; pollen, snake skin; lakes, Sphagnum; MAINE, USA. \u2261<em>Lobulomyces angularis <\/em> D.R.
